The AFV ASSOCIATION was formed in 1964 to support the thoughts and research of all those interested in Armored Fighting Vehicles and related topics, such as AFV drawings. The emphasis has always been on sharing information and communicating with other members of similar interests; e.g. German armor, Japanese AFVs, or whatever.

490,000 Euros which is $653,758. No engine or transmission. A tad over priced IMHO. A working Grizzly goes for $325,000 and an M5A1 Stuart goes for around $250,000. (Which some argue are also over priced.)

If one was fortunate enough to buy it and an authentic powertrain was not available, would you adapt an off-the-shelf engine and transmission and put in it or leave as is?

- VonForhud
why buy it, if it cant move? Its not like engine and transmission is something you pick up at the local constructors store/hardware supplier.


A Maybach HL 120 TRM engine and Pz IV automotive components are fairly easy to source for a collector (many have more than one unit on hand already). If not shooting for absolute accuracy a Tatra diesel sollution is close enough.
